Ситуация, когда документ вместо ожидаемого текста превращается в бессмысленный набор китайских иероглифов, вопросительных знаков или странных символов, вызывает недоумение и раздражение. Пользователь отправляет на печать обычный отчет или письмо, а на выходе получает лист, напоминающий страницу из древней книги или матричного кода. Это не признак поломки печатающей головки или засора картриджа, а фундаментальная ошибка интерпретации данных.
В основе проблемы лежит рассогласование между тем, как компьютер упаковывает информацию, и тем, как принтер понимает приходящий поток байтов. Устройство получает команду, которую оно трактует неверно, превращая символы текста в графические примитивы или кодированные последовательности, не имеющие отношения к исходному файлу. Разобраться в причинах и устранить сбой можно самостоятельно, не прибегая к вызову специалиста.
Наиболее часто виновником выступает драйвер печати, который либо устарел, либо был установлен некорректно. Также проблема может скрываться в выборе неверного языка описания страницы (PDL), сбоем буфера памяти или повреждением системных файлов шрифтов в операционной системе. Понимание природы этих сбоев — ключ к быстрому восстановлению работоспособности устройства.
Ошибки драйверов и несовместимость ПО
Самая распространенная причина появления иероглифов — использование неподходящего программного обеспечения. Если вы установили универсальный драйвер вместо специализированного для вашей модели HP LaserJet или Canon PIXMA, устройство может не справляться с декодированием сложных команд. Компьютер отправляет данные в формате, который принтер не распознает, и вместо текста выдает хаотичные символы.
Иногда проблема возникает после автоматического обновления Windows, которое подменяет родной драйвер на более универсальный, но менее точный. В этом случае система пытается использовать стандартный протокол, который часто конфликтует с прошивкой конкретного устройства. Необходимо проверить версию установленного ПО и сравнить её с актуальной версией на сайте производителя.
Важно обратить внимание на тип используемого драйвера: PostScript, PCL или RAW. Если в настройках принтера выбран режим PostScript, а драйвер отправляет данные в формате PCL, возникнет полный хаос в символах. Несоответствие языка описания страницы (PDL) между драйвером и устройством является главной причиной печати иероглифов в 80% случаев.
⚠️ Внимание: Не все драйверы совместимы с конкретными ревизиями аппаратной платы. Даже если модель принтера совпадает, ревизия "A" может требовать другого ПО, чем ревизия "B".
Решение проблемы часто заключается в полной переустановке драйверов. Удалите старое ПО через панель управления, перезагрузите компьютер и скачайте свежую версию драйвера, строго соответствующую вашей модели и версии операционной системы. Используйте официальный установщик, а не встроенные стандартные драйверы ОС.
Проблемы с кодировкой и портами подключения
Другой распространенной причиной сбоя является физическое или логическое нарушение канала связи. Если принтер подключен через старый параллельный порт (LPT) или некачественный кабель USB, данные могут передаваться с ошибками. Принтер получает "битые" пакеты информации и интерпретирует их как произвольный код.
В операционной системе Windows настройки портов могут быть сбиты. Часто срабатывает автоматический выбор порта, который не соответствует реальному подключению. Например, устройство подключено физически в USB 1, но система пытается отправить данные через LPT1. Это приводит к тому, что данные либо не доходят, либо искажаются в пути.
Проверьте настройки порта в свойствах принтера. Убедитесь, что выбран правильный USB-порт (например, USB001, USB002) или соответствующий сетевой IP-адрес. Если используется кабель, попробуйте заменить его на другой, желательно экранированный и короткой длины.
- 🔌 Проверьте целостность USB-кабеля и отсутствие перегибов.
- 🔧 Убедитесь, что в Диспетчере устройств нет конфликтов с другими устройствами.
- 🔄 Попробуйте подключить принтер к другому USB-порту на компьютере.
- 📡 Для сетевых принтеров проверьте стабильность соединения и IP-адрес.
⚠️ Внимание: Если вы используете переходники (например, USB на LPT), риск возникновения ошибок при передаче данных возрастает в разы. По возможности подключайте устройство напрямую.
Иногда проблема кроется в настройках буфера печати. Если буфер переполнен или фрагментирован, данные могут прийти к принтеру не в той последовательности, что приведет к сбою декодирования. Очистка очереди печати и перезапуск службы диспетчера печати (Print Spooler) часто помогают решить эту проблему.
Ошибки языка описания страницы (PDL)
Принтеры понимают язык, на котором написаны данные для печати. Основными стандартами являются PCL (Printer Command Language) и PostScript. Если драйвер настроен на отправку данных в формате PCL 5, а принтер ожидает PCL 6 или PostScript, он интерпретирует управляющие коды как текст. Результатом становятся иероглифы, странные символы или пустые страницы.
В настройках драйвера в разделе Свойства принтера необходимо найти вкладку Дополнительно или Данные для печати. Здесь часто можно выбрать язык описания страницы. Если стоит "Автоматически", попробуйте принудительно указать нужный стандарт, который поддерживается вашей моделью. Для большинства офисных лазерных принтеров это PCL, для фотопринтеров — часто PostScript.
Иногда помогает смена режима передачи данных с RAW на Text или наоборот в свойствах порта. В окне Свойства порта перейдите на вкладку Споры и проверьте настройки протокола. Неправильная настройка здесь приводит к тому, что заголовки файлов данных воспринимаются как полезная нагрузка.
Если вы используете специализированное ПО для печати этикеток или чеков (например, ZebraDesigner или Bartender), убедитесь, что выбран правильный шаблон принтера. Ошибка в выборе модели в программе может привести к отправке команд, несовместимых с физическим устройством.
☑️ Проверка настроек PDL
Повреждение шрифтов и системных файлов
Иногда проблема не в принтере, а в компьютере. Если системные файлы шрифтов повреждены или удалены, программа (например, Word или PDF-ридер) не может корректно отформатировать текст перед отправкой на устройство. Вместо символов в поток данных попадают служебные коды, которые принтер пытается "нарисовать" как графику.
Проверьте наличие поврежденных шрифтов в системе. Зайдите в папку C:\Windows\Fonts и попробуйте удалить дубликаты или явно поврежденные файлы. Попробуйте распечатать тестовую страницу из Блокнота (Notepad), который использует базовые системные шрифты. Если в Блокноте печать корректная, а в Word — нет, проблема в файле документа или шрифтах, используемых в документе.
В случае с PDF-файлами проблема может быть в том, что встроенные шрифты файла некорректно внедрены. Попробуйте сохранить документ как PDF/A или распечатать его через виртуальный принтер в формат изображения, а затем отправить на печать как картинку. Это исключит использование шрифтов принтера.
⚠️ Внимание: При переустановке Windows или обновлении системы файлы шрифтов могут быть повреждены. Рекомендуется периодически проверять целостность системных файлов командой
sfc /scannow.
Для исправления ситуации можно запустить проверку диска и восстановление системных файлов. Откройте командную строку от имени администратора и выполните команду восстановления. Это займет время, но может устранить скрытые ошибки файловой системы, влияющие на работу с текстом.
Как проверить целостность шрифтов
Зайдите в "Панель управления" -> "Шрифты". Попробуйте открыть каждый шрифт в отдельном окне. Если окно не открывается или отображается мусор — шрифт поврежден. Удалите его и установите заново из официального источника.
Перегрев и сбой памяти принтера
Принтеры имеют собственную оперативную память, в которой буферизируются данные перед печатью. Если объем передаваемого файла превышает возможности памяти устройства, или если модуль памяти неисправен, данные могут быть обрезаны или искажены. Принтер начинает "глючить", выдавая случайные символы вместо текста.
Перегрев контроллера также может вызывать сбои в обработке данных. Если принтер работает в режиме плотной печати без перерывов, электроника может нагреваться до температур, при которых начинаются ошибки вычислений. В этом случае печать может начинаться нормально, но через несколько страниц появляются иероглифы.
Попробуйте выполнить сброс памяти устройства. Выключите принтер из розетки, подождите 2-3 минуты, чтобы полностью разрядить конденсаторы, и включите снова. Это очистит буфер и перезапустит процессор. Если проблема повторяется, возможно, требуется замена модуля памяти или прошивки.
- 🌡️ Дайте принтеру остыть в течение 15-20 минут.
- 💾 Очистите очередь печати на компьютере перед повторной попыткой.
- 🔋 Проверьте, не перегружена ли память устройства большими файлами.
- 🛠️ Обновите прошивку (firmware) до последней версии с сайта производителя.
В некоторых случаях помогает уменьшение качества печати или сложности графики. Если вы печатаете высококачественные изображения с большим количеством деталей, принтер может не справляться с обработкой. Попробуйте снизить разрешение печати в настройках драйвера.
Если после всех манипуляций проблема сохраняется, возможно, неисправна основная плата управления (Main Board). В этом случае потребуется профессиональная диагностика и замена электронного модуля. Самостоятельный ремонт платы возможен только при наличии соответствующего оборудования и навыков.
Перед отправкой больших объемов данных на печать делайте паузы между заданиями, чтобы дать памяти принтера очиститься и остыть электроники.
Таблица типичных ошибок и решений
Для быстрого устранения проблемы можно воспользоваться сводной таблицей, где указаны основные причины появления иероглифов и соответствующие методы их решения. Это поможет систематизировать процесс поиска неисправности.
| Симптом | Вероятная причина | Решение |
|---|---|---|
| Полный набор иероглифов на всей странице | Неверный драйвер или язык PDL | Переустановить драйвер, сменить PCL на PostScript |
| Часть текста нормальная, часть — иероглифы | Переполнение памяти принтера | Очистить буфер, уменьшить сложность файла |
| Иероглифы только в начале страницы | Ошибка в заголовке файла | Проверить настройки порта, обновить прошивку |
| Иероглифы в одном приложении, в другом — нет | Настройки конкретного ПО | Настроить драйвер в свойствах приложения |
| Хаотичные символы при печати из PDF | Проблемы с шрифтами PDF | Сохранить как изображение или печать в виде картинки |
Регулярная проверка состояния принтера и своевременное обновление программного обеспечения позволяют избежать большинства подобных проблем. Не игнорируйте предупреждения системы о проблемах с драйверами. Если устройство начало вести себя странно, лучше сразу проверить его настройки, чем доводить ситуацию до необходимости замены оборудования.
Правильная настройка языка описания страницы (PDL) и использование актуальных драйверов — основа стабильной работы принтера и гарантия отсутствия иероглифов на печати.
FAQ: Часто задаваемые вопросы
Почему принтер печатает иероглифы только из Word, а из Блокнота нормально?
Это указывает на проблему с шрифтами или форматированием внутри файла Word. Возможно, документ использует шрифты, которые не установлены на компьютере или не поддерживаются драйвером принтера. Попробуйте сохранить документ в PDF или распечатать его как изображение.
Помогает ли отключение и повторное включение принтера?
Да, полная перезагрузка устройства (выключение из розетки на 2 минуты) очищает оперативную память принтера и сбрасывает буфер ошибок, что часто решает проблему случайных сбоев в обработке данных.
Может ли кабель USB вызывать печать иероглифов?
Да, поврежденный, экранированный или слишком длинный кабель может искажать данные при передаче. Если кабель поврежден, биты информации могут меняться, превращая текст в нечитаемые символы. Замените кабель на новый и качественный.
Что делать, если проблема появилась после обновления Windows?
Скорее всего, Windows автоматически установила несовместимый драйвер. Зайдите в "Диспетчер устройств", найдите принтер, нажмите "Обновить драйвер" и выберите "Выполнить поиск драйверов на этом компьютере", указав путь к скачанному официальному драйверу с сайта производителя.
Стоит ли покупать новый принтер, если он печатает иероглифы?
В большинстве случаев это программная проблема, а не аппаратная. Попробуйте переустановить драйвер, обновить прошивку и проверить настройки порта. Замена устройства нужна только если основная плата управления физически неисправна.